  • Bangkok, Thailand

    • Highlights

      • Known for its vibrant street life and ornate temples like Wat Arun and Wat Phra Kaew
      • Expansive event venues like Bangkok International Trade & Exhibition Centre
      • Culinary scene blending traditional Thai cuisine with modern international flavors
      • Scenic Chao Phraya River cruises ideal for unique group activities
      • Proximity to cultural sites like the Grand Palace and Chinatown
      • Thriving arts and nightlife scene with rooftop bars and night markets
